Which statement best characterizes opportunity cost?
Tasya [4]

Answer:

c. the value of a product that you give up in a tradeoff with another product.

Explanation:

The principle or concept of opportunity cost comes in when faced with alternative choices in a situation whereby only one option has to be selected or chosen. For instance, one is faced with a decision to make to select either of option A or option B. By choosing option A, option B is the opportunity cost and vice versa. The dividends or benefits of the option which isn't chosen is called the opportunity cost. In other words, the benefits of the foregone alternative is called the opportunity cost.

Why does Mr. Jabez Wilson write so much in "The Red-Headed League"?
Stolb23 [73]
Mr. Jabez-Wilson writes so much in "The Red-Headed League" because he takes up a useless job for The Red-Headed League, which is an office for males with ginger hair. He is told to copy the Encyclopedia Britannica, which has loads of pages and is one of the biggest books in history. When he goes up to Sherlock Holmes to let him know of this weird sort of engagement, he has not even finished copying all of the information under the letter "A".
